2017-03-29 1 views
-3

div에 대한 HTML 배경색 채우기를 만들려고하면 맨 아래쪽에 엄청난 양의 여백이 생깁니다. 헤더 유형을 만들고 싶지만 실제로는 넓은. 누군가 이걸로 나를 도울 수 있습니까?HTML5 배경색 채우기가 너무 많음

내 HTML은

입니다
<div class="header"> 
    <h1>Welcome to My Site</h1> 
</div> 

내 CSS는

div.header{ 
    background-color:grey; 
} 

덕분입니다!

+1

더 많은 코드를 추가하십시오 - 일부 html은 도움이 될 것입니다 –

+1

정확히 무엇을 의미하는지 보여주는 예 (코드 스 니펫에서)를 작성하십시오. – Terry

답변

0

부트 스트랩을 사용하는 것이 좋습니다. 커뮤니티 지원 및 설명서가 많이 있으며 색상 및 스타일을 직접 무시할 수도 있습니다.

부트 스트랩 우물은 당신을 위해 일할 수 있습니다.

<div class="well"> 
    Look, I'm in a well! 
</div> 

또는 더 큰 영향을주는 점보 트론.

<div class="jumbotron"> 
    <h1>Jumbotron</h1> 
    <p>This is a simple hero unit, a simple jumbotron-style component for calling extra attention to featured content or information.</p> 
    <p><a class="btn btn-primary btn-lg">Learn more</a></p> 
</div> 
1

코드에 너비, 높이 및 여백을 추가하는 것이 좋습니다. codepen.io와 같은 웹 사이트로 코드를 실험해볼 수 있습니다! 다음은 내가 말하는 것에 대한 예에 대한 링크입니다.

https://codepen.io/wykydtronik/pen/VpEGer

div.header{ 
    background-color:grey; 
    width: 350px; 
    height: 150px; 
    margin: 0 auto; 
} 

당신이 CSS 코드를 보면 당신은 내가 350px의 폭과 150 픽셀의 높이를 설정 볼 수 있습니다. 나는 또한 여백을 추가했다 : 0 자동; 헤더 div를 가운데로 만듭니다. 몇 번 보았을 때까지 직관적이지 않은 깔끔한 트릭입니다.

도움이 될지 알려주세요. 행운을 비네!